The Westar color hex code is #d4cfc5, and it is composed of 83% red, 81% green and 77% blue.
Westar is a light, dull, desaturated, and warm color at 7% saturation. It has a contrast ratio of 1.55:1 against a white background, which fails WCAG AA (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ines, Level AA) compliance.
For better visibility, it is recommended to use the Westar color (#d4cfc5) against dark backgrounds.

Westar Color Codes and Information
Here’s a complete breakdown of the color Westar, including its HEX, RGB, HSL, and CMYK values, as well as other information about the color.
| Data Type | Values/Details |
|---|---|
| Hex | #d4cfc5 |
| RGB | rgb(212,207,197) |
| HSL | hsl(40,14.9%,80.2%) |
| CMYK | 0, 2, 7, 17 |
| HSV | 40, 7, 83 |
| RGB % | 83, 81, 77 |
| XYZ | 59.5, 62.7, 61.8 |
| LAB | 83.3, -0.2, 5.6 |
| Color Category | Light |
| Color Family | Gray |
| Saturation | 7% |
| Temperature | Warm |
| Contrast Ratio Againt White (#ffffff) | 1.55 (fails WCAG AA) |
| Contrast Ratio Againt Black (#000000) | 13.53 (passes WCAG AA) |
